FUNERAL FUNDS ACT 1979 - SECT 11
Contributory funeral benefit business to be carried on only by companies registered under this Act
(1) A person must not carry on or advertise that the person carries on or is
willing to carry on any contributory funeral benefit business unless that
person is a funeral contribution fund. Maximum penalty: 20 penalty units or,
in the case of a continuing offence, 2 penalty units for each day the offence
continues.
(2) Without limiting the application of subsection (1), a person
carries on contributory funeral benefit business if the person undertakes to
provide contributors with a funeral service in New South Wales.
